Embers Billboard, 1972
Unlike many Embers billboards of the 1970s era, this one was configured right-side-up instead of upside-down. (The Embers folks apparently believed that flipped billboards caught the eye. They were right.) This particular Embers—the Richfield version—is now a Mexican restaurant called Andale Taqueria y Mercado.
Photo via Minnesota Historical Society
